Beyond Scared Straight: Maryland inmates give a group of five at-risk teens a taste of prison when they are forced to eat �Lock-up Loaf,� a brick of baked mush served to unruly prisoners.
Documentary
Watch Beyond Scared Straight Season 01 Episode 06 M4uhd for free in HD quality. Stream instantly with English subtitles — no download or account needed.